Skip to main content

CMake is an open-source, cross-platform family of tools designed to build, test and package software

Project description

CMake is used to control the software compilation process using simple platform and compiler independent configuration files, and generate native makefiles and workspaces that can be used in the compiler environment of your choice.

The suite of CMake tools were created by Kitware in response to the need for a powerful, cross-platform build environment for open-source projects such as ITK and VTK.

The CMake python wheels provide CMake 3.27.0.

Latest Release

Versions

Downloads

https://img.shields.io/pypi/v/cmake.svg https://img.shields.io/badge/downloads-3997k%20total-green.svg

Build Status

GitHub Actions (Windows, macOS, Linux)

PyPI

https://github.com/scikit-build/cmake-python-distributions/actions/workflows/build.yml/badge.svg

Platforms

The following platforms are supported with binary wheels:

OS

Arch

Windows

64-bit
32-bit

Linux Intel

manylinux2010+ 64-bit
musllinux 64-bit
manylinux2010+ 32-bit
musllinux 32-bit

Linux ARM

manylinux2014+ AArch64
musllinux AArch64

Linux PowerPC

manylinux2014+ ppc64le
musllinux ppc64le

Linux IBM Z

manylinux2014+ s390x
musllinux s390x

macOS 10.10+

Intel

macOS 11+

Apple Silicon

The last version to provide manylinux1 wheels was 3.22.x.

Maintainers

Miscellaneous

License

This project is maintained by Jean-Christophe Fillion-Robin from Kitware Inc. It is covered by the Apache License, Version 2.0.

CMake is distributed under the OSI-approved BSD 3-clause License. For more information about CMake, visit http://cmake.org

History

cmake-python-distributions was initially developed in September 2016 by Jean-Christophe Fillion-Robin to facilitate the distribution of project using scikit-build and depending on CMake.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

cmake-3.27.0.tar.gz (35.2 kB view details)

Uploaded Source

Built Distributions

cmake-3.27.0-py2.py3-none-win_arm64.whl (34.1 MB view details)

Uploaded Python 2 Python 3 Windows ARM64

cmake-3.27.0-py2.py3-none-win_amd64.whl (34.6 MB view details)

Uploaded Python 2 Python 3 Windows x86-64

cmake-3.27.0-py2.py3-none-win32.whl (31.1 MB view details)

Uploaded Python 2 Python 3 Windows x86

cmake-3.27.0-py2.py3-none-musllinux_1_1_x86_64.whl (27.8 MB view details)

Uploaded Python 2 Python 3 musllinux: musl 1.1+ x86-64

cmake-3.27.0-py2.py3-none-musllinux_1_1_s390x.whl (26.4 MB view details)

Uploaded Python 2 Python 3 musllinux: musl 1.1+ s390x

cmake-3.27.0-py2.py3-none-musllinux_1_1_ppc64le.whl (30.3 MB view details)

Uploaded Python 2 Python 3 musllinux: musl 1.1+ ppc64le

cmake-3.27.0-py2.py3-none-musllinux_1_1_i686.whl (29.5 MB view details)

Uploaded Python 2 Python 3 musllinux: musl 1.1+ i686

cmake-3.27.0-py2.py3-none-musllinux_1_1_aarch64.whl (26.2 MB view details)

Uploaded Python 2 Python 3 musllinux: musl 1.1+ ARM64

cmake-3.27.0-py2.py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l (26.0 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.17+ x86-64

cmake-3.27.0-py2.py3-none-manylinux2014_s390x.manylinux_2_17_s390x.whl (25.2 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.17+ s390x

cmake-3.27.0-py2.py3-none-manylinux2014_ppc64le.manylinux_2_17_ppc64le.whl (28.9 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.17+ ppc64le

cmake-3.27.0-py2.py3-none-manylinux2014_i686.manylinux_2_17_i686.whl (27.1 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.17+ i686

cmake-3.27.0-py2.py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l (25.4 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.17+ ARM64

cmake-3.27.0-py2.py3-none-manylinux2010_x86_64.manylinux_2_12_x86_64.whl (25.0 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.12+ x86-64

cmake-3.27.0-py2.py3-none-manylinux2010_i686.manylinux_2_12_i686.whl (25.7 MB view details)

Uploaded Python 2 Python 3 manylinux: glibc 2.12+ i686

cmake-3.27.0-py2.py3-none-macosx_10_10_universal2.macosx_10_10_x86_64.macosx_11_0_arm64.macosx_11_0_universal2.whl (47.4 MB view details)

Uploaded Python 2 Python 3 macOS 10.10+ universal2 (ARM64, x86-64) macOS 10.10+ x86-64 macOS 11.0+ ARM64 macOS 11.0+ universal2 (ARM64, x86-64)

File details

Details for the file cmake-3.27.0.tar.gz.

File metadata

  • Download URL: cmake-3.27.0.tar.gz
  • Upload date:
  • Size: 35.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/4.0.2 CPython/3.11.4

File hashes

Hashes for cmake-3.27.0.tar.gz
Algorithm Hash digest
SHA256 d03f0a76a2b96805044ad1178b92aeeb5f695caa6776a32522bb5c430a55b4e8
MD5 05ba7cb1fa24f6feefe4bcbb251b0e2c
BLAKE2b-256 2630924ebe4c9b4fb65365b89542f4bcf681bf34c48230140ab02e5bd7e898e8

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-win_arm64.whl.

File metadata

  • Download URL: cmake-3.27.0-py2.py3-none-win_arm64.whl
  • Upload date:
  • Size: 34.1 MB
  • Tags: Python 2, Python 3, Windows 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/4.0.2 CPython/3.11.4

File hashes

Hashes for cmake-3.27.0-py2.py3-none-win_arm64.whl
Algorithm Hash digest
SHA256 6f46a170b0c9c552d52da4346534570f818195dfc4f1d0c03264e24cc348fc60
MD5 eb586b00728bd99af4d9295f094297d0
BLAKE2b-256 958a0b0f306bcabe5eec1fecd6e520ca4886976fc1e8e9335fb3b60fb4c351ca

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-win_amd64.whl.

File metadata

  • Download URL: cmake-3.27.0-py2.py3-none-win_amd64.whl
  • Upload date:
  • Size: 34.6 MB
  • Tags: Python 2,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/4.0.2 CPython/3.11.4

File hashes

Hashes for cmake-3.27.0-py2.py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 48be3afe62c9513a49be007896a4058fafec512cb1f269a50126da30aacad97f
MD5 ec26f50b4e7d13f2115faec37c58cb58
BLAKE2b-256 78cf42d206fc2679902e9408688a6e75215215e7781faf88653b2738c599e70a

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-win32.whl.

File metadata

  • Download URL: cmake-3.27.0-py2.py3-none-win32.whl
  • Upload date:
  • Size: 31.1 MB
  • Tags: Python 2, Python 3, Windows x86
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/4.0.2 CPython/3.11.4

File hashes

Hashes for cmake-3.27.0-py2.py3-none-win32.whl
Algorithm Hash digest
SHA256 5561aca62b65aac844f3931e74cfeb696e4534de145e3307bf942e735736541e
MD5 030de2e78f2ff104be6883a17a309e0a
BLAKE2b-256 74554c1140a800616735c5388994bfd1d04deb2c5b60aeba2a0bc467189b0479

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-musllinux_1_1_x86_64.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-musllinux_1_1_x86_64.whl
Algorithm Hash digest
SHA256 c4c968c188e7518deb463a14e64f3a19f242c9dcf7f24e1dbcc1419690cd54e0
MD5 989c407361d09e245414f6eede41921f
BLAKE2b-256 bdb91ca9d7b8e521634ab35ce30fd6118ce84ee99ff947c5c3ae6b4b8fbd13cd

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-musllinux_1_1_s390x.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-musllinux_1_1_s390x.whl
Algorithm Hash digest
SHA256 1b3189171665f5c8d748ae7fe10a29fff1ebeedeaef57b16f1ea54b1ec0fe514
MD5 49db0b469caaa00d71d0bfb49b9ad183
BLAKE2b-256 b4aa03a34e6e819550e46eb3536ef1221fa837188b069ea949d9b05e7f0f91d9

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-musllinux_1_1_ppc64le.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-musllinux_1_1_ppc64le.whl
Algorithm Hash digest
SHA256 9740ed9f61a3bd8708a41cadd5c057c04f38e5b89bd773e369df2e210a1c55a3
MD5 ed0881022d4ccaba22ca5c2f8facf086
BLAKE2b-256 da4aca7595211362e499da6420f13a13d1b7706ea4617ebd0fe42b7b8898f7ce

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-musllinux_1_1_i686.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-musllinux_1_1_i686.whl
Algorithm Hash digest
SHA256 e58e48643903e6fad76274337f9a4d3c575b8e21cd05c6214780b2c98bb0c706
MD5 a061ccf3510d90624f1eb3e287679d89
BLAKE2b-256 5b3a69a9796bae112964085c2ac6cd1b7f93567d7c160276976cbc0d04e217c4

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-musllinux_1_1_aarch64.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-musllinux_1_1_aarch64.whl
Algorithm Hash digest
SHA256 073e4f196d0888216e6794c08cd984ddabc108c0e4e66f48fbd7610d1e6d726d
MD5 25f9e4d2f4d5e00369d5e826574d8082
BLAKE2b-256 caad51a16998ea339ad6129bcbdf916c8a4e21ae407e02719e18abfba5a560b6

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2014_x86_64.manylinux_2_17_x86_64.whl
Algorithm Hash digest
SHA256 b9d5811954dcedcaa6c915c4a9bb6d64b55ac189e9cbc74be726307d9d084804
MD5 6ebb0a1439b4d150c902eaf918eb7163
BLAKE2b-256 14b806f8fdc4687af3d3d8d95461d97737df2f144acd28eff65a3c47c29d0152

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2014_s390x.manylinux_2_17_s390x.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2014_s390x.manylinux_2_17_s390x.whl
Algorithm Hash digest
SHA256 1f38d87b2c65763a0113f4a6c652e6f4b5adf90b384c1e1d69e4f8a3104a57d6
MD5 88a53a76d13da19b68baab30df7f2166
BLAKE2b-256 82a7f7934296e769f228e4220da04d6c13ae17c9d10160b9dfa705ca687d63a8

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2014_ppc64le.manylinux_2_17_ppc64le.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2014_ppc64le.manylinux_2_17_ppc64le.whl
Algorithm Hash digest
SHA256 35a8d397ce883e93b5e6561e2803ce9470df52283862264093c1078530f98189
MD5 cef05816e4f077acdf2df467252b2116
BLAKE2b-256 fbf65eb9fded8587efab4bba0a1983844472cccb5dabe23e37dd56025fb6644a

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2014_i686.manylinux_2_17_i686.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2014_i686.manylinux_2_17_i686.whl
Algorithm Hash digest
SHA256 b470ccd3f86cf19a63f6b221c9cceebcc58e32d3787d0d5f9f43d1d91a095090
MD5 81be8e2782ed10a6ee0bf75478380813
BLAKE2b-256 3d1375b5687c91364515eae0cf783e557cd34f210228f4026aed841785e73488

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2014_aarch64.manylinux_2_17_aarch64.whl
Algorithm Hash digest
SHA256 58a3f39d3d1bc897f05e531bfa676246a2b25d424c6a47e4b6bbc193fb560db7
MD5 e1f476e3c018d3b573f09ce3687f25c2
BLAKE2b-256 5fb4a5a8fcd36287d38eb93cdab6a42520ec60eae760d1f92536c330b826eae1

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2010_x86_64.manylinux_2_12_x86_64.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2010_x86_64.manylinux_2_12_x86_64.whl
Algorithm Hash digest
SHA256 8745eff805f36762d3e8e904698b853cb4a9da8b4b07d1c12bcd1e1a6c4a1709
MD5 c15d83fef3807a1f293e2e24cc1cce6c
BLAKE2b-256 03362b154a089fddf951304a1454010ec948f16f7bf014890243c7eaea50f6c5

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-manylinux2010_i686.manylinux_2_12_i686.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-manylinux2010_i686.manylinux_2_12_i686.whl
Algorithm Hash digest
SHA256 199bfaefb752e82d8067aeee5d6a6e0414fe0d60e9a3fd08e95d537a97e0db16
MD5 6d6e0300c01ec3815071ee20ee3e14ab
BLAKE2b-256 bf5caf9d062dda09f3f763336af9b1b148d1dc03d61aa99c010282489c896d6a

See more details on using hashes here.

Provenance

File details

Details for the file cmake-3.27.0-py2.py3-none-macosx_10_10_universal2.macosx_10_10_x86_64.macosx_11_0_arm64.macosx_11_0_universal2.whl.

File metadata

File hashes

Hashes for cmake-3.27.0-py2.py3-none-macosx_10_10_universal2.macosx_10_10_x86_64.macosx_11_0_arm64.macosx_11_0_universal2.whl
Algorithm Hash digest
SHA256 9ccab4cd93578d3c2df32e66b44b313b75a7484032645040431dc06a583ca4aa
MD5 31099d7eb9c08b25286859a99eb39952
BLAKE2b-256 8a2b042528c0ce76d53ea4dfa305048e4f9914954421188c1f006c15b2814a0b

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page